Culture Days are Here!
Join Us for Free Events Happening Now through October 16 in Richmond Hill
RICHMOND HILL – The City of Richmond Hill and the Richmond Hill Public Library invite you to take part in Culture Days, a national celebration of arts and culture, on now until October 16. Join us for an array of barrier-free events throughout the city as we celebrate arts, culture and creativity!
The three-week festival celebrates the world of artists, creators, historians, architects, curators and designers. Events include art exhibits, city tours, workshops and demonstrations that bring the diversity, culture and spirit of our community to life.
